Full Notice Text
STATE OF ILLINOIS CITY OF SHELBYVILLE NOTICE OF LETTING Sealed proposals will be received in the office of the City Clerk, 170 E Main St., Shelbyville, Shelby County until 10:00 a.m., March 24, 2026 for seal coat oil and rock materials required in the maintenance of various City of Shelbyville streets, 2026 MFT, and publicly opened and read at that time. Proposals shall be submitted on forms furnished by the City which may be obtained in the office of the City Clerk and shall be enclosed in an envelope endorsed "MATERIAL PROPOSAL 26 MFT", as indicated above. The right is reserved to reject any and all proposals and to waive technicalities. Proposal guarantee will be required. All bidders shall bid in accordance with the Check Sheet LRS-7 of the Supplemental Specifications and Recurring Special Provisions of the Illinois Department of Transportation adopted January 1, 2026. Prequalification of bidders will be required. Not less than the prevailing rate of ages as determined by the public body of the Illinois Department of Labor shall be paid to all laborers, workers, and mechanics performing work under this contract. BY ORDER OF: Rachel Wallace City Clerk 11485-962290
